Shropshire based Journalism and PR celebrates 1st Birthday
A Shropshire sole-trader who started up a public relations company in the middle of the recession this week celebrated the company's first birthday after going from strength to strength throughout the past 12 months.
Journalism and PR was launched by Rhea Alton,29, on April 6 last year following a seven-year career in local newspapers.
The business, based in Castlefields, Shrewsbury, offers freelance journalism, public relations for businesses and events large and small and media training courses.
Rhea said: "When I launched the business I had a couple of clients and I now have 13 on my books. I love all aspects of the job, from doing PR for sole-traders in Shrewsbury to being the press officer for the Cosford Air Show.
"I am so pleased that it has all gone so well and have to thank the members of the Severn Business Network group, who have been the secret tool behind my success since I joined in June last year.
"Business continues to get better and better and I am looking forward to the next 12 months and all the challenges my second year running my own business will bring."
